The Charlotte Hornets and Philadelphia 76ers submitted a joint entry for the sloppiest 20-second stretch of this young NBA season.
Late in the first quarter Wednesday night, we saw a Hornet retrieve the ball only to have his pocket picked, an uncontested fast-break layup spill out, a full-court pass intercepted, and a missed alley-oop dunk.
The Hornets - who usually commit the fewest turnovers in the league with 8.7 per game - finished with a season-high 15 in the game, yet still managed to win handily, 109-93.
